We had a great meal here on New Year's Day. It was busy, as you would expect, and it took a while to order and get our food but everything came out hot. Food was great, drinks were full and our waitress was pleasant.
Been here before and will definitely be going back.

Been coming to this location for a few years now, they have a new manager and let me tell you, that man is good. I haven't had a chance to speak with him but he looks ex-military or something. He is consistently keeping the place in order, sweeping, bussing tables, cashing out customers, and this morning he was in the back cooking the pancakes and French toast. They were some of the best tasting and visually appealing that Ive ever had at this location. Hopefully he sticks around, as if Knox Abbot wasn't already good, he is definitely a welcome asset to the location. 10/10 definitely coming back.
